nodejs eslint airbnb

It eliminates installing bunch of devDependencies everytime setting up a new project - Makes setup easier. Install and save the necessary packages for ESLint and the Airbnb configuration. Limited. N Sharma. Who's Using ESLint? Perhaps in a distant future, we could use literate programming to structure our README as test cases for our .eslintrc? Node.js API; Maintainer guide; Blog; Demo; About. That is. asked Oct 4 '17 at 10:33. ESLint depends on donations for ongoing maintenance and development. the ESlint config docs Maintenance. First, download and install Node.js. VS Code is a popular code editor created by Microsoft. Its package manager, npm, is included with the installation. If you don't need React, see eslint-config-airbnb-base. Greetings human code-scavenger. 45 / 100. Creating a React project using a custom template. Install the correct versions of each package, which are listed by the command. Now , let’s build the API server with Node.js ( Express). This is the directory in which I want to configure ESLint. Luckily Airbnb has written a Style Guide for JavaScript which covers most of the best practices they use. npm install eslint-config-airbnb -D. There is no need to install peer-dependencies because they are already included in Create React App. $ cnpm install tslint-config-airbnb . If you are using vue-cli, your needs … They also publish a version for React applications as eslint-config-airbnb. 5 min read. It flags programming errors, indentation errors, formatting errors, bugs, and suspicious constructs. Limited. There is a VS Code extension for ESLint which will integrate it’s linting features right in your editor. To install ESLint and setup a config file, we’ll use another npx package script. Airbnb's ESLint config with TypeScript support. (If you are using an official Node.js distribution, SSL is always built in.) ## ESLint + Airbnb + Prettier: These tools will be identifying, reporting and formatting on patterns found in ECMAScript/JavaScript code, with the goal of making the code more consistent and avoiding bugs. Make sure the open source you're using is safe to use Secure my Project. It can work together with ESLint to catch errors and enforce a consistent code style throughout the project. In this post, I’ll show you how to set it all up. Add Airbnb to the ESLint config. for follow the rule and standard of them. javascript node.js eslint eslint-config-airbnb prettier. Learn about our RFC process, Open RFC meetings & more. It uses original Airbnb Style config extended with JavaScript Standard Style config (with semicolons). 7 min read. Any subdirectories within this one will also use the configuration we are about to set up. Run the following command to install: ```sh: npm install eslint \ eslint-config-airbnb-base \ eslint-config-prettier \ eslint-plugin-import \ npx install-peerdeps --dev eslint-config-airbnb, npm install --save-dev eslint-config-airbnb eslint@^#.#.# eslint-plugin-jsx-a11y@^#.#.# eslint-plugin-import@^#.#.# eslint-plugin-react@^#.#.# eslint-plugin-react-hooks@^#.#.#, install-peerdeps --dev eslint-config-airbnb. Implement API server with Node.js. About the Team; About ESLint; Open search. In order for it to work, you need to configure it with specific rules. We couldn't find any similar packages Browse all packages. A TSLint config for Airbnb JavaScript Style Guide ESLint plugins used by this config must also be installed within your project. As such, we scored eslint-config-airbnb-standard popularity level to be Small. One of the nice features is that you can enable extensions that make your life as a developer easier. Type ESLint in the search bar. It is a pluggable and configurable linter tool for identifying and reporting on patterns in JavaScript. Now that TSLint is being deprecated in favor of a collaborative solution with ESLint (typescript-eslint), we are switching back to ESLint, Airbnb rules, and Prettier. ESLint is a tool for “linting” your code. ESLint + AirBnB ESLint is a linter which will analyze your code and find common issues, while also identifying styles inconsistent with AirBnB’s style guide if configured. and if … Change directories into the root directory for any coding you do. Security review needed. Inactive. If using npm < 5, Linux/OSX users can run. If using npm < 5, Windows users can either install all the peer dependencies manually, or use the install-peerdeps cli tool. It requires eslint, eslint-plugin-import, eslint-plugin-react, eslint-plugin-react-hooks, and eslint-plugin-jsx-a11y. View the list of whitespace rules here. As in the name, Prettier makes you code look prettier. you can read documentation of Airbnb javascript style guide. Compare configs. Community. Consider adding test cases if you're making complicated rules changes, like anything involving regexes. See eslint-config-airbnb-base. Combined with ESLint, the two are powerful tools for writing good code. This modules provides a flexible way to integrate Eslint + Airbnb style guide conventions + Prettier. enforce consistent indentation (indent) The --fix option on the command line can automatically fix some of the problems reported by this rule. Now create .eslintrc.js with the following contents: ESLint is installed and configured for Airbnb’s style guide. However, this is not recommended, and any plugins or shareable configs that you use must be installed locally in either case. ⭐️ In diesem Video zeige ich dir wie du in VSCode ESLint und Prettier konfigurierst. Following this style guide will ensure your code has a level of clarity that makes reading and maintaining your code easier for anyone who has to work on it. In the root of your project open the package.json file. Now we need to get it working in VS Code. If using yarn, you can also use the shortcut described above if you have npm 5+ installed on your machine, as the command will detect that you are using yarn and will act accordingly.Otherwise, run npm info "eslint-config-airbnb@latest" peerDependencies to list the peer dependencies and versions, then run yarn add --dev @ for each listed peer dependency. By default open RFC meetings & more or use the configuration we are about to set the project as... In the search results and click the green install button nodejs eslint airbnb to it warn you of errors! Best practices they use the Airbnb configuration it can analyze your code styleguide the. Covers most of the best practices they use ESLint is the directory which. Is used by this config must also be installed locally in either case an open source you 're is... Airbnb rules for React applications as eslint-config-airbnb dependency for eslint-config-airbnb-base guide that is used by config... Go ahead and close VS code is a great start either install all the peer dependencies manually or. Badges 399 399 bronze badges VS code extension for ESLint which will integrate it ’ s a... Shareable configs that you can enable extensions that make your life as a developer easier process, open RFC &... Node.Js & Express project using Babel work, you need to configure ESLint all packages and. - Makes setup easier for identifying and reporting on patterns in code as an extensible shared.! All up luckily, Airbnb — as Part of their Style guide that nodejs eslint airbnb used by JavaScript... Changes, like anything involving regexes up a minimal Node.js & Express project Babel. Have ESLint ready for you start a new project, you will be warned of errors. Life as a developer easier either install all the peer dependencies manually, or =11.10.1. Or use the install-peerdeps cli tool bash, zsh, or use the install-peerdeps cli tool linting! Installed and configured for Airbnb ’ s important to have a consistent code format and Style a... Enables the linting rules for the Node.js Application integrate it ’ s basically a of. You how to set up JavaScript standard Style config ( with semicolons ) for ESLint will. Zsh, or > =11.10.1 ) built with SSL support using is to! Project you work in a team or a slightly larger project it ’ s the... For identifying and reporting on patterns in JavaScript then re-open it or shareable configs that you use be. Eslint-Config-Airbnb-Standard popularity level to be Small and sets all other rules to warnings ESLint which will integrate it ’ build! & Express project using Babel a NodeJS project originally developed by Nicholas C. in! Perhaps in a distant future, we could use literate programming to structure our README as cases. Extends '': [ `` Airbnb '' to the extends option nodejs eslint airbnb Prettier eslint-plugin-prettier eslint-config-prettier eslint-config-airbnb-base eslint-plugin-node 3. Correct versions of each package, which are listed by the command for... S important to have a consistent code format and Style in a NodeJS project start a project! Project up as node/npm project npx package script package, which are listed by command! Eslint plugins guide ; Blog ; Demo ; about ESLint ; open search vscode ESLint! Prettier Makes you code look Prettier install button next to it larger project it ’ s linting right! Versions from official npm registry.. TSLint config for Airbnb JavaScript Style guide I ’ ll show how... Team ; about ESLint ; open search Airbnb has written a Style guide have. Dominant tool for “ linting ” your code you may alternatively install Powershell you ’ find... Your.eslintrc 1 ) install ESLint plugins used by this config must also installed. Jsx, with some nice rules and sets all other rules to warnings guide conventions + Prettier,,! Of their Style guide — provides an ESLint configuration that anyone can use: NodeJS, browser jest! Within this one will also use the configuration we are about to set the project up node/npm. Degree, your environment will probably be ready to go for these instructions guide — provides ESLint! Npm run Lint a terminal ( or command prompt ) sync missed versions official! Project using Babel.. TSLint config Airbnb ongoing maintenance and development Style guide powerful tools for writing good code it... Vscode - ESLint, the airbnb-base ESLint config docs for more information Values: NodeJS, browser,,... This post, I will show you how to get ES Lint, the two are powerful tools for good. In NodeJS can use this way essential guide Airbnb maintains a very popular JavaScript Style guide — provides ESLint! A distant future, we could n't find any similar packages Browse all packages bash... Tree ) to evaluate patterns in nodejs eslint airbnb JavaScript which covers most of the nice features is you. Lint working with Vue JS above example, the two are powerful for. Open RFC meetings & more ( Node.js > = 8.10 and npm are installed, you have... Node.Js & Express project using Babel is the directory in which I want to configure ESLint for you source linting! Basically a collection of different rules the dominant tool for identifying and reporting on patterns code... It requires ESLint, eslint-plugin-import is a computer program that analyzes and checks source code this... Either install all the peer dependencies manually, or use the install-peerdeps cli.... Guide for JavaScript which covers most of the best practices they use from npm... Demo ; about Node and npm are installed, open RFC meetings & more und Prettier konfigurierst, ECMAScript! A peer dependency for eslint-config-airbnb-base code is a computer program that analyzes checks... Alternatively install Powershell to go for these instructions look Prettier harassment helper for Create React App supporting and. Of your project open the package.json file need a terminal ( or command ). C. Zakas in June 2013, you need a terminal ( or command prompt ) ESLint which will integrate ’. Is a computer program that analyzes and checks source code registry.. TSLint config Airbnb is that can!

Concentration In Biology, Code The Hidden Language Of Computer Hardware And Software Flipkart, Punctuate The Following Sentences Examples, Finland Coffee Consumption Per Capita, Note Taking Tips For Visual Learners, Krylon Farm & Implement Paint, Kima Glass Cebu Contact Number, Pizza Dough Calculator Reddit, Abba Zaba Bars Where To Buy, Jobs For 15 Year Olds In Norfolk Virginia, Act 4, Scene 2 Othello Summary, Black Cat Names Reddit, Houses For Rent In Countryside, Ffxiv Spruce Plywood, Everglades Swamp Tours Coupon,